Company Introduction – Technology Sector Overview

The technology sector comprises companies engaged in the research, development, production, and distribution of technological goods and services. These organizations range from multinational corporations to innovative startups delivering digital solutions across industries such as healthcare, finance, manufacturing, education, and entertainment. Technology companies are typically innovation-driven, relying heavily on research and development to maintain market relevance and competitive advantage.


Company Developments – Recent Industry Updates

In recent years, the technology industry has witnessed rapid advancements and strategic shifts. Companies are increasingly investing in AI-powered solutions, cloud infrastructure, and cybersecurity platforms to meet rising digital demands. Mergers, acquisitions, and strategic partnerships have become common as firms seek to expand capabilities, enter new markets, and enhance technological expertise. Additionally, the global rollout of 5G networks and increased focus on data privacy and regulatory compliance continue to shape strategic decision-making across the sector.


Strategic Analysis Review – SWOT Analysis of the Technology Sector

A SWOT analysis provides valuable insight into the overall strategic position of the technology industry:

Strengths include strong innovation capacity, scalable digital business models, and global customer reach.
Weaknesses often involve high R&D costs, rapid product obsolescence, and dependency on skilled talent.
Opportunities arise from expanding demand for cloud computing, AI, automation, and digital transformation in emerging markets.
Threats include intense competition, cybersecurity risks, regulatory challenges, and supply chain disruptions.

This strategic framework highlights why agility and continuous innovation are critical for long-term success in the technology market.


Business Description and Key Products & Services

Technology companies operate across multiple segments, offering a diverse portfolio of products and services. Core offerings typically include software applications, cloud-based platforms, IT services, networking solutions, and digital infrastructure. Many firms also provide subscription-based services, managed solutions, and consulting services, enabling recurring revenue streams and long-term customer relationships. Emerging technologies such as AI, blockchain, and edge computing further enhance product differentiation and market growth.


Financial Analysis – Ten-Year Historical Trends

Over the past decade, the technology industry has demonstrated consistent revenue growth driven by digital adoption and innovation. Software and cloud-based companies have generally reported higher profit margins compared to traditional hardware businesses, largely due to scalable and subscription-based revenue models. Strong cash flows have enabled continued investment in R&D, acquisitions, and global expansion. Despite economic cycles, the technology sector has shown resilience, making it one of the most attractive industries for long-term investors.


Competitors and Industry Analysis

The technology industry is highly competitive, featuring global leaders, regional players, and disruptive startups. Competition is driven by innovation speed, pricing strategies, brand strength, and customer experience. Large multinational companies dominate mature markets, while agile startups often lead in niche or emerging technology segments. Industry competition is further influenced by rapid technological change, customer demand for integrated solutions, and increasing regulatory oversight.
